to birdie
01
to complete a hole in golf in one stroke fewer than the standard par
Beispiele
She birdied the 7th hole with a precise iron shot.
Birdie your way through the course to improve your score.
Birdie
01
a projectile consisting of a rounded cork or rubber base with a feathered skirt, designed to be struck back and forth over a net in badminton
Beispiele
She served the birdie over the net with perfect aim.
The birdie landed just inside the boundary line.
02
Birdie, Vögelchen
(golf) a score of one stroke less than the par value for a hole, typically achieved by sinking the ball into the hole with one fewer stroke than the expected number
Beispiele
He sank a birdie putt from six feet away.
Er versenkte einen Birdie aus sechs Fuß Entfernung.
The golfer celebrated after making a birdie on the par-3 hole.
Der Golfer feierte, nachdem er ein Birdie auf dem Par-3-Loch gemacht hatte.
03
Vögelchen, kleiner Vogel
used to refer to a small or young bird, often used in a casual or affectionate manner
Beispiele
The children watched the little birdie hop around the garden.
Die Kinder beobachteten den kleinen Vogel im Garten herumhüpfen.
She pointed to the birdie in the tree, excited to see such a tiny creature.
Sie zeigte auf den Vogel im Baum, aufgeregt, solch ein kleines Wesen zu sehen.
